Trump budget could cut research funding for Washington U, SLU - Angela Mueller, St. Louis Business Journal

Local organizations could feel the effect of funding cuts to research institutions such as the National Institutes of Health included in President Donald Trump's budget. The White House budget proposal, which was submitted to Congress on Thursday, includes a $5.8 billion reduction, or 18 percent, in funding going to the NIH, the New York Times reports. More than 80 percent of the NIH's budget goes to outside researchers, according to the Washington Post, and local institutions such as Washington University, Saint Louis University and Southern Illinois University Edwardsville are among those receiving funds from the organization. http://www.bizjournals.com/stlouis/news/2017/03/17/trump-budget-could-cut-research-funding-for.html
